With 57,401 degrees handed out in 2020-2021, social work is the 9th most popular major in the United States.
Across Maine, there were 352 social work gra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 265 social work graduates with average earnings and debt of $53,717 and $0 respectively.
For this year’s “Most Well Attended Social Work Major in Maine for a Master’s” ranking, we looked at 3 colleges that offer a degree in social work. This ranking identifies schools that graduate the most students in social work.

Top 3 Most Popular Master’s Degree Colleges for Social Work in Maine
You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of New England. The school came in at #1 for the Most Well Attended Social Work Major in Maine for a Master’s. UNE is located in Biddeford, Maine and, has a medium-sized student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 170 masters’s social work degrees to qualified students.
The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 1.8%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Southern Maine.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Most Well Attended Social Work Major in Maine for a Master’s list. University of Southern Maine is a medium-sized public school situated in Portland, Maine. It awarded 48 masters’s social work degrees in 2020-2021.
The low undergrad student loan default rate of 4.2%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Maine. The school came in at #3 for the Most Well Attended Social Work Major in Maine for a Master’s. University of Maine is located in Orono, Maine and, has a fairly large student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 47 masters’s social work degrees to qualified students.
The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 4.0%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.
